There are various companies in the United States and abroad that offer intellectual property insurance, and each one offers a slightly different policy with different guiding rules and regulations, so make sure you and your intellectual property lawyer sit down and read the entire contract that is offered to you. For instance, if you are planning on primarily distributing your intellectual property over the Internet, it might be a good idea to buy a policy that affords extra protection for digital media distribution. Generally, intellectual property insurance helps to protect companies, and sometimes individuals, from the costs of defending their intellectual property rights in court. Domestic intellectual property right cases can be quite lengthy, but when you involve places and law systems where intellectual property right enforcement is lax or even non-existent, cases can be drawn out for years. It is this fear that makes intellectual property right insurance so popular.
If you have recently patented your own personal piece of intellectual property, it is a good idea to buy intellectual property insurance if you feel that there is a chance that you may be sued by another individual or company for violating their intellectual property.
